History

Founded in 2017, There is News is a satire website based in Spain.

Read our profile on Spain’s media and government.

Funded by / Ownership

There is News does not disclose ownership and revenue is generated through advertising.



Analysis / Bias

In review, There is News disclaims in their tagline that they are a satire site with this: “Not real, but so funny.” A typical satire story reads like this The man is more fertile the more hair is on his chest, according to a study. Although this source is written in English, it is generally not grammatically correct or easy to read, but it is pretty funny.

Overall, we rate There is News a satire website based on clear disclosure of satire status. (D. Van Zandt 6/8/2019)
